Home Cladding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Home cladding installation services involve applying protective and decorative materials to the exterior walls of a property. This process enhances the building’s appearance, provides additional insulation, and helps protect against weather elements. Projects can range from updating the facade of a single-family home to larger commercial or multi-unit residential buildings. Homeowners typically seek cladding installation when renovating or improving the durability and aesthetic appeal of their property, or when replacing old or damaged siding to maintain structural integrity.
Before requesting home cladding installation, property owners often want to understand the different types of cladding materials available, such as vinyl, wood, fiber cement, or metal, and how each suits their specific needs and style preferences. It’s also helpful to consider factors like maintenance requirements, durability, and compatibility with existing structures. Clarifying the scope of the project, including the number of walls to be covered and any necessary preparatory work, can ensure a smooth process and satisfactory results.

Common Home Cladding Installation Jobs
Vinyl siding installation - enhances curb appeal with durable, low-maintenance cladding options.
Fiber cement siding - provides a weather-resistant exterior that mimics traditional materials.
Wood siding - adds natural warmth and character to residential facades.
Metal cladding - offers a sleek, modern look with long-lasting protection.
Stone veneer installation - creates a timeless, upscale appearance for home exteriors.
Composite siding - combines durability and style for versatile cladding solutions.
Home Cladding Installation Questions
What types of materials are used for home cladding?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its.
Can home cladding improve energy efficiency? Yes, properly installed cladding can help insulate a property, reducing heat transfer and enhancing energy performance.
Is home cladding suitable for all types of buildings? Cladding can be applied to various residential structures,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-story buildings.
What are typical reasons for installing new cladding? Common reasons include updating the appearance, repairing damaged siding, or enhancing weather resistance.
